Biography of Fabio Lanzoni
Fabio Lanzoni, known simply as Fabio to millions, really became a cultural phenomenon. Born on March 15, 1959, in Milan, Lombardy, Italy, he carved out a very unique path for himself in the public eye. His journey from a young man in Italy to a globally recognized figure is, you know, quite a story, showing how someone can truly capture the public's imagination.
His early life in Milan, like, gave him a grounding, with his father, Sauro, working in a conveyor belt factory and his mother, Flora, having been a beauty pageant winner. This background, in a way, hints at both a practical side and a flair for public presentation, which arguably shaped his future career. He really did come from a pretty normal setting, which makes his later fame all the more striking.

Personal Details and Bio Data
Detail | Information |
---|---|
Full Name | Fabio Lanzoni |
Born | March 15, 1959 |
Age | 65 (as of 2024) |
Birthplace | Milan, Lombardy, Italy |
Parents | Sauro (father), Flora (mother, former beauty pageant winner) |
Occupation | Actor, Fashion Model, Spokesman |
Known For | Romance book covers, People Magazine cover (1993), Bubble Boy (2001), Dumbbells (2014), Dude, Where's My Car |
Hobbies | Avid motorcyclist (owns over 300 motorcycles including dirt bikes, racing bikes, and a championship Ducati) |
Other Ventures | Runs his own production company, specializing in animation |
The Rise to Fame: 80s and 90s Icon
Fabio's ascent to widespread fame really picked up speed in the 1980s and 1990s. He became the quintessential image of romance and passion, gracing the covers of countless romance novels. His ripped physique and flowing hair were, you know, instantly recognizable, making him a very sought-after figure for these book covers. This was, in a way, his signature look that millions came to associate with him.
He was, basically, everywhere during those decades. You'd see him on billboards, in various advertisements, and, of course, on those book covers that captured so many imaginations. This level of visibility, you know, really cemented his status as a pop culture icon. It's almost hard to imagine the media landscape of that time without his presence, honestly.
Fabio himself, apparently, feels that he truly "arrived" in 1993, when he appeared on the cover of People magazine. This shoot, he remembers, was in Hawaii, and it was a pretty big moment for his public image. Being featured in such a prominent publication, you know, really elevated his profile beyond just the romance novel world, making him a more mainstream celebrity.

Beyond the Covers: Acting and Endorsements
Fabio wasn't content to just stay on book covers; he expanded his career into acting. He appeared in films like Bubble Boy in 2001, which was, you know, a pretty fun role for him. He also showed up in Dumbbells in 2014 and had a part in Dude, Where's My Car? These roles, even if they were smaller, kept him in the public eye and diversified his professional activities, which is a pretty smart move for a celebrity.
Beyond acting, Fabio became a very recognizable spokesman for various products. He was, for example, famously associated with hair care ranges, which made a lot of sense given his iconic mane. A Passion for Wheels: Fabio's Motorcycle Collection
Beyond his public career, Fabio has a very passionate hobby that also represents a significant personal asset: he's an avid motorcyclist. This isn't just a casual interest; he actually owns over 300 motorcycles, which is, you know, a pretty incredible collection. This includes a wide variety of bikes, like dirt bikes, racing bikes, and even a championship Ducati, which is a rather impressive machine.
A collection of this size and quality, honestly, represents a considerable investment. Motorcycles, especially high-performance or rare ones, can be quite valuable. Building an Empire: Production Company Ventures
Fabio has also, apparently, ventured into the business world beyond just being a public face. He runs his own production company, which, surprisingly to some, specializes in animation. This is a pretty interesting pivot for someone known primarily for their physical presence, showing a broader range of interests and business acumen.
